Decoding Gut Symptoms
Unveiling the clues behind digestive discomfort and unbalanced gut health
-
Abdominal Pain
Abdominal pain is any form of discomfort between the chest and the pelvis, and severe symptoms could be a sign of serious gastrointestinal trouble.
-
Anal/Rectal Bleeding
Rectal bleeding describes any blood that passes through your anus – it is assumed to be blood that is present in your lower colon or rectum.
-
Bloating
Bloating is a stomach issue that happens when you retain fluid, or when gas builds up in the digestive tract as a result of problems or overeating.
-
Blood in the Stool
Blood in the stool, whether dark or light, means that you have blood somewhere within your digestive tract that needs to be examined further.
-
Bowel Incontinence
Bowel incontinence happens when you are unable to control your bowel movements and can range from complete loss of control to irregular stool leaks.
-
Constipation
Constipation occurs when stool becomes too hard and dry. But constant and severe symptoms can mean something more serious.
-
Diarrhoea
Diarrhea, (loose, watery bowel movements) is a common gut symptom, but sometimes severe symptoms can mean something more serious is happening.
-
Difficulty Swallowing
Patients may experience difficulty swallowing food or liquid due to food allergies, muscle spasms, esophagitis, or other types of issues.
-
Heartburn
Heartburn is a burning sensation accompanied by pain and a bitter or acidic taste that happens after eating a meal when lying down or bending over.
-
Indigestion
Indigestion can impact how full you feel after consuming a meal, cause bloating in the upper abdomen, and cause overall discomfort.
-
Nausea
Nausea is the sensation that makes you feel like you have to vomit, and if persistent, can point to a symptom of an underlying condition or issue.
-
Unexplained Weight Gain/Loss
Unexplained weight loss or gain is when a notable drop or increase in weight happens when not trying, and can be a symptom of an underlying illness.
-
Vomiting
Vomiting is the body’s natural response to protecting you against threats like infection, ingested poisons, or harmful substances.
